Greenhouse grower
Greenhouse growers manage crops raised under glass or plastic, where temperature, light, humidity, irrigation, and feed are all controlled rather than left to the weather. The role is part plant husbandry and part systems management, since climate computers, fertigation lines, and biological pest control all have to be tuned together. Crops run to a tight production schedule.

What the work involves
Set and adjust climate, irrigation, and fertigation targets on the greenhouse control system.
Walk the crop to assess growth stage, fruit set, root health, and pest pressure.
Manage biological and chemical pest control programmes and record every application.
Direct planting, training, pruning, and picking teams to hit the production plan.
Check nutrient solution readings and irrigation drain rates and correct drift.
Log crop registration data and review it against the target production curve.

How people commonly enter
Starting as a greenhouse worker and progressing to grower with on-the-job training.
A college certificate or diploma in horticulture, greenhouse production, or plant science.
A bachelor's degree in horticulture or plant science for head-grower and technical roles.
Specialist short courses in crop registration, integrated pest management, or climate control taken while employed.
Typical training: Certificate or college diploma
Licensing: Certification common, not usually required
